3. USE AND MAINTENANCE
3.16 PROBLEM SOLVING
PROBLEM POSSIBLE CAUSES
– The air conditioner does not work.
– The air conditioner does not refrigerate the room.
– Strange smell in the room. Water drips from the
air conditioner.
– The remote control does not work.
– The air conditioner does not work for 3 min
when switched on.
POSSIBLE SOLUTIONS
1. Wrong setting of the timer / Check it.
2. Problems on the power supply / Call the service
center.
3. The filter could be dirty / Clean it.
4. The room temperature is too high / Wait
until the temperature goes down.
5. The temperature is not properly set / Check
it.
6. The grids could be obstructed / Check and
remove the eventual obstacles.
--Dampness in the room, coming from walls,
carpets, furnishing or similar.
--Wrong installation of the air conditioner.
--Wrong connection of the drainage pipe.
--Exhausted batteries.
--Wrong insertion of the batteries inside the
remote control.
--Protection of the conditioner. Wait for 3 min
and the air conditioner will start to work again.
If the supply cord damaged, it must be replaced by
manufacturer or its service agent or a similarly
qualified person in order to avoid a hazard.
